1. Hygrometers: monitoring humidity levels
The role of hygrometers : These devices measure the humidity level in the air, helping to manage humidity effectively.
Application : Use hygrometers to identify problem areas and adjust ventilation or dehumidification strategies accordingly.
2. Dehumidifiers: a modern solution
When to use a dehumidifier : In cases of excessively high humidity, a dehumidifier can be an effective tool.
Choosing the Right Dehumidifier : Consider the size of the space and humidity level when selecting a dehumidifier.
Preventive Measures: Keeping Moisture At Bay
Regular maintenance : Keep gutters clean and repair any leaks quickly.
Insulation : Good insulation, especially in areas like attics and basements, can prevent moisture buildup.
